HNC CONSTRUCTION MANAGEMENT YEAR 1 (DAY RELEASE)

This course is for prospective students, keen on a professional role in the construction industry, or for experienced construction operatives, who are looking to up-skill and enhance their promotion prospects.

Start Date: August 2023
Days of Week:  TBC
Time: 9am-4pm
Duration:  2 years
Cost: £750 per year

The course focuses on the key knowledge required by a construction technician, site supervisor/agent/manager, to provide a strong grounding in construction methods, procedures, organisation and contractual arrangements.

  • What the course includes

    You will learn over 2 years contemporary technical roles, currently required by the construction industry:

    • Construction Contracts & Procedures
    • Substructures
    • Domestic Construction
    • Industrial & Commercial Construction Methods
    • Construction Health & Safety
    • Site Administration
    • Computer Aided Draughting (CAD)
    • Building Services Introduction
    • Building Services In Large Buildings
    • Construction Site Surveying
    • Building Measurement & Cost Studies (Quantity Surveying)
    • Construction Materials Testing & Specification
    • Construction Planning
    • Graded Unit Project

Entry requirements

  • NC in a related discipline or
  • Minimum one Higher level pass and relevant passes at Standard Grade or
  • Credit/National 5 in relevant subjects, including science/technology or
  • SVQ in construction or related discipline or
  • Foundation Apprenticeship in a related subject or
  • Craft qualification combined with appropriate further study before/along with HNC programme

We consider relevant industrial experience/other qualifications on an individual basis.

If English is not your first language, ESOL Level 5 is an entry requirement for this course.

  • Where it leads

    Education:

    Further Study - Degree Courses

    Successful completion of the HNC will allow students to apply for Year 2 entry to construction courses at:

    Edinburgh Napier University (articulation agreement)

    • BSc Hons Construction and Project Management
    • BSc Hons Quantity Surveying
    • BSc Hons Building Surveying

    Glasgow Caledonian University

    • BSc Hons Quantity Surveying
    • BSc Hons Construction Management
    • BSc Hons Building Surveying
